// Heads up for release: this constant caps how many bytes the Fernwheel
// uploader sniffs when guessing encoding for text files. We tried 512 and
// kept misreading long UTF-16 exports from Castermill clients, so it's 4096
// now. Don't shrink it without rerunning the detection suite. The build that
// validated this change is noted below.

build token for kagaf-hahof: htk14_9d3d4d26d7d8de

// Stale-branch cleanup bot — constants for the Mossgate repo fleet.
// Support: if a customer reports a missing branch, check the bot's
// audit log first; restores are possible within the retention window.
// The bot only targets branches with no commits past the idle cutoff
// and never touches anything matching the protected patterns.
// Do not hand-edit these values in prod; change them via the config
// rollout pipeline so staging picks them up first.
// Current tuning values follow.

tuning table, faduf-baduf:
PRIORITIES = {
    "ulavan": 191,
    "silys": 750,
    "goriel": 238,
    "kelmir": 66,
    "wendor": 432,
}

### FAQ: Who do I contact about the Driftpile stale-cache postmortem?

The March stale-cache incident on the Driftpile catalog service was caused by a TTL misconfiguration in the Hearthrow edge layer; cached product pages served data up to six hours old. The postmortem doc lives in the incident archive under INC-Driftpile-Cache. The remediation items (TTL audit, cache-bust hook) are owned by the Edge Reliability group. If you're on call and see a recurrence, page Edge Reliability, then send a summary to the address below.

alerts address for kajog-tadup: druox@plorvanet.internal

Subject: Lease renegotiation — Carwick Tower

Team,

Quick update before Thursday's board session. The landlord has come back on the Carwick Tower lease: they'll drop the escalation clause if we commit to five years. Honestly, better than expected. Finola has modelled both options and the five-year deal saves real money, assuming headcount holds. We'd also get first refusal on the ninth floor. I'd like a decision this month so we lock the terms. The strategic angle worth knowing is this.

management briefing: Project Ulavan slips by two quarters because of the staffing delay.